Fog Monster 2: Summon ground crawling mist for your tabletop minis

March 13, 2020 by Andrew Girdwood Leave a Comment

Fog Monster 2 is a smoke machine that’s built into gaming tiles. It’ll turn your gaming den, if you have one, into a kick-ass mini-movie set.

Disney and Pixar’s Onward is actually getting a Quests of Yore RPG

March 13, 2020 by Andrew Girdwood Leave a Comment

The new RPG is called Quests of Yore: Barkey’s Edition and comes with 1 advanced players guide, 1 quest tone, 180 power, spell and item cards, 24 hex titles, 4 conviction tokens, a quest screen, character sheets, miniatures, dice and other rules.
